That or go to 4 small divisions and tell teams they can only play the P5/P4


So if ND is in a smaller division of 4 and break them into regional divisions, this could happen.

ACC North: ND, Navy, BC,and Syracuse. That's 3 games and 1 that you are already playing frequently and covers where you get the majority of your students. Most fans under rate how important that is to a President/Leader of a University.

Then you also play ACC Mid-Atlantic for two years. Let's Say Virginia, Virginia Tech, Louisville and Pittsburgh. That means 7 games, that still leaves you room for Stanford, USC etc, You end up with a much better opportunity to make the playoff. You cover a huge portion of the country every 6 years and you keep a national schedule.

The two years after that you play the same three North teams, but then you play North Carolina, Duke, NC State and Wake. The Carolina division.

Then you rotate to Georgia Tech, Clemson, FSU and Miami. ACC South.
